What are named subcontractors?
What does Named sub-contractor mean? A sub-contractor who is named by the employer in the specification or employer's requirements. The contractor bears the risk of the named sub-contractor's procurement and design (in contrast with the position in relation to nominated sub-contractors).

What is an example of a subcontractor?
Subcontractors can be anything from an individual self-employed person - eg a plumber carrying out work for a building contractor - to a large national organisation. A subcontractor has a contract with the contractor for the services provided - an employee of the contractor cannot also be a subcontractor.

What's the difference between a contractor and a subcontractor?
Typically, a contractor works under a contractual agreement to provide services, labor or materials to complete a project. Subcontractors are businesses or individuals that carry out work for a contractor as part of the larger contracted project.
